As an instructor in sustainable food and agricultural systems at Northeast Wisconsin Technical College, Valerie Dantoin is helping create career paths for students who want to become farmers, or become closer to the land.

If you close your eyes and you just imagine what you would think of as an organic farm, you probably get this image of a nice cow out on green grass. That happens on our farm. It doesn’t always happen on every organic farm and it certainly doesn’t happen anymore on farms that we call conventional farms.

-- Valerie Dantoin
